Abstract: To isolate ammonia from gas mixtures containing ammonia and carbon dioxide, the gas mixture is first partially absorbed in a solvent, with residence times of at most 0.1 second, and the non-absorbed gas is then separated from the solution obtained. The solution is then subjected to a first desorption stage, in which only the ammonia present in an excess over a molar ratio of 3 parts of ammonia to 1 part of carbon dioxide is expelled by heating, and the entrained carbon dioxide is washed out of the expelled ammonia by means of solutions containing free ammonia. The solution remaining after the first desorption stage is substantially freed from ammonia and carbon dioxide in a second desorption stage and the expelled gas, containing solvent, together with fresh gas mixture is fed to the adsorption stage, while the solvent obtained from the second desorption stage is employed for the absorption.

Abstract: Shell-and-tube heat exchanger having an inlet opening for product vapour, inlet and and outlet openings for cooling agent which is conducted in the heat exchanger (transfer) tubes, a purge stub for removing inert gases, and a discharge stub for product condensate, in which a) the shell-and-tube heat exchanger (1) is arranged vertically, b) the arrangement of the heat exchanger tubes (2) in the region of the side where the product vapour flows at first has large spacings, which are increasingly reduced in the course of the path of the main flow, and c) a plurality of purge stubs for inert gases (5) are arranged one above another opposite the inlet opening for product vapour (4) in the region of the tightest packing of the heat exchanger tubes (2).
